Canadian films are being added to the Toronto International Film Festival’s main program, including "Back in Black" featuring Christopher Walken. The Toronto International Film Festival has announced it will include several Canadian movies in its lineup, showcasing a mix of local talent and storytelling. Among the titles is "Back in Black," which stars the renowned actor Christopher Walken. The festival, held in Toronto, is known for highlighting international cinema, and this addition reflects a growing emphasis on Canadian contributions. The inclusion of these films underscores the festival’s commitment to diverse and compelling narratives. The announcement was made by the festival organizers, who highlighted the importance of supporting Canadian filmmakers. This move is expected to draw attention to the country’s cinematic landscape and its place on the global stage. (winnipegfreepress.com)
